The family of a woman who went missing in Saskatoon two years ago is asking for more information from the public.
Gallagher has been missing since September 2020. A year after her disappearance, Saskatoon police said they were treating the case as a homicide. Two people have now been charged in the case with offering an indignity to human remains, but Gallagher's father points out, no one is facing a charge for homicide.
